1. Select Your Adventure

  • Research: Explore the offerings of reputable adventure travel companies specializing in K2 expeditions or trekking in Pakistan.
  • Consider Your Experience: Evaluate your physical fitness, mountaineering skills, and comfort level with high-altitude environments.
  • Choose a Trip: Select a trip that aligns with your experience level, desired duration, and budget.

2. Gather Information

  • Itinerary: Review the detailed itinerary, including daily activities, accommodation, and transportation.
  • Cost: Understand the total cost, including expedition fees, permits, equipment rentals (if applicable), and personal expenses.
  • Inclusions: Clarify what’s included in the package (e.g., guides, porters, meals, equipment) and what’s not.

3. Book Your Trip

  • Deposit: Pay a deposit to secure your place on the expedition. The amount may vary depending on the company and trip.
  • Payment Options: Choose a payment method accepted by the company (e.g., credit card, bank transfer).
  • Confirmation: Receive a confirmation email or document outlining the booking details, including payment schedule, visa information, and emergency contact details.

4. Prepare for the Expedition

  • Visa: Obtain the necessary visa for Pakistan. The requirements may vary depending on your nationality.
  • Equipment: Ensure you have the appropriate gear, including clothing, footwear, and specialized equipment for high-altitude trekking or climbing.
  • Training: Consider undergoing specific training or preparation for the expedition, such as high-altitude training or mountaineering courses.
  • Health and Insurance: Obtain necessary health checkups and travel insurance that covers high-altitude activities and emergency medical evacuation.

Additional Considerations

  • Acclimatization: Plan for adequate acclimatization to high altitudes to reduce the risk of altitude sickness.
  • Permits: Obtain the required permits from the Pakistani government for trekking or climbing in the K2 region.
  • Local Customs: Familiarize yourself with local customs, traditions, and etiquette to respect the culture and environment.
